Which of your products did you highlight as Terrot at ITM 2024 Exhibition?
We presented our latest innovations and technologies in the field of circular knitting machines. At our booth, we introduced our I3P 196 open width frame (diameter 34’, gauge E32, number of feeders: 108), which is also our Interlock blockbuster Turkey market with Smartex system. The I3P 196 is a highly productive and flexible circular knitting machine producing ‘8-lock’, interlock and modified structures such as double face, punto di roma, milano rib, piqué rodier and also racer mesh with maximum efficiency. Equipped with up to 4 needle tracks in cylinder cam and 2 needle tracks in dial cam the I3P 196 promises maximum flexibility and a wide range of pattern options.
We teamed up in our booth with Smartex, who provide among others a state-of-the-art AI driven error detection system. The Smartex CORE system build-in on our exhibition machine gives the customer the power of latest hardware and software technology to control their fabric production, inspecting every inch of fabric using artificial intelligence algorithms, which are constantly being upgraded.

What are your predictions for the future of textile and how are you preparing for the future as a company?
We expect the demand for double jersey machines to increase, especially for the Turkish market. As a company, we are looking for the best solution for our customers. The sustainability of the machines and at the same time the best fabric quality is important for us. So I think fabric quality is the best value we can offer to our customers. If you have a quality machine, you get the best fabric and it is as sustainable as possible.
Why is ITM 2024 so important for the industry this year?
We have seen a lot of problems in the market. In the past the demand was not so high. But now I think the outlook is very positive. We are expecting a better year for both 2024 and 2025. I am very optimistic that demand will increase and we will see a great potential especially in the double jersey market.
